Old School New Body Reviews and Complaints Old School New Body is a digital fitness and nutrition program created specifically for people over 35 who are fed up with one-size-fits-all plans and endless cardio routines that eat up time with little return. Old School New Body was put together by Steve and Becky Holman, with Steve bringing decades of experience as the Editor-in-Chief of Iron Man Magazine and longtime contact with training veterans and anti-aging experts, and Old School New Body is presented as a downloadable e-book and companion materials that you can access immediately after purchase. Old School New Body also aims directly at anti-aging concerns by targeting hormonal signals like human growth hormone release through intense, targeted resistance work, and it pairs that strategy with guidance on healthy fats and hydration so the body has the nutritional building blocks to recover and maintain muscle. Old School New Body makes the case that you do not have to live at the gym to see lasting change; instead, the program shows how a focused set of exercises, the right intensity, and a few nutritional shifts produce better outcomes for middle-aged trainees than hours of cardio or complicated workout splits.
